Biographical Note
Harold J. McWhinnie was a professor in the Department of Curriculum and Instruction, University of Maryland, from 1970 until he retired in 1997. He is a ceramic artist.
Collection Overview
The collection consists of research papers on art, art education, and art theory from 1901 through 2000 and his brief comments about them. The papers include part of his work, published and unpublished. The collection is also a repository for papers, presentations, and dissertations which he considered to have value to art education and theory. Specific topics include art education; aesthetics; art appreciation; art and the brain; and the uses of technology by and for art.
